Output 21580fae297068bb4d1c21138a59a049878c92b1a783f9ae6400b70ee20260bf:1

value
203982467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d61befe9391a8018ed2bd8d31a0069661ffc261 OP_EQUAL
address
MExKMiZBE5wDFxCLDhqA974UQ7UQve3Jho
transaction
21580fae297068bb4d1c21138a59a049878c92b1a783f9ae6400b70ee20260bf
spent
true